A driver has been charged after a car collided with pedestrians during Liverpool's celebration, resulting in numerous injuries.

Topics covered
A recent incident during Liverpool’s Premier League victory parade turned a joyous occasion into a scene of chaos and distress. Following the team’s triumph, a car drove into a crowd of fans, injuring at least 79 people, among whom were a child and several adults.
The situation escalated from a moment of celebration to a tragic reminder of the unpredictability of such events.
Details of the incident
Paul Doyle, a 53-year-old resident of West Derby, has been charged with multiple offenses including dangerous driving and causing grievous bodily harm with intent.
He is scheduled to appear before Liverpool magistrates on Friday, as the police continue their investigation into the circumstances surrounding the collision. Witnesses reported that the car veered onto Water Street, where crowds gathered to celebrate the team’s historic achievement, leading to panic and injuries.
Victims and injuries
The aftermath of this tragic event saw at least 79 individuals requiring medical attention, with two suffering serious injuries, including one child. As of the latest reports, seven victims remain hospitalized but in stable condition. Disturbingly, the youngest injured person was just nine years old, while the oldest was 78, underscoring the wide reach of this tragic occurrence.
Investigation and police response
In a press briefing, Sarah Hammond, Chief Crown Prosecutor for CPS Mersey-Cheshire, highlighted that the investigation is in its early stages. Authorities are meticulously reviewing extensive evidence, which includes video footage and countless witness statements, to ensure that justice is served for all affected individuals. Hammond emphasized the importance of thoroughness in this sensitive case.
Public reaction and ongoing concerns
Assistant Chief Constable Jenny Sims addressed the public’s concerns during the news conference, acknowledging the shock and sadness that has permeated the community. She reassured the public that detectives are working diligently to uncover the truth behind this incident. The police believe that Doyle acted independently and have ruled out any motives related to terrorism, focusing instead on the driver’s actions leading up to the collision.
Eyewitness accounts
Eyewitnesses recounted harrowing scenes as the vehicle struck fans, with one video capturing the moment a person wrapped in a Liverpool flag was thrown into the air. The joyous atmosphere of celebration quickly shifted to horror as bystanders rushed to help the injured. Detective Superintendent Rachel Wilson urged the public to refrain from speculating about the incident and sharing distressing content online, as the investigation continues.
